From the pasture the red and white cow sent after them a broken-spirited "Moo!" Bos'n was highly indignant.

During the homeward walk she sputtered like a damp firecracker.
"The idea of her talking so to you, Uncle Cyrus!" she exclaimed.

"It wasn't your fault at all." The captain smiled one-sidedly.
"I don't know about that, shipmate," he said.

"I wouldn't wonder if she was more than half right.

But say! she was all business and no frills, wasn't she! Ha, ha! How she did spunk up to that heifer! Who in the dickens do you cal'late she is ?".
